1. Nespresso Vertuo Plus

The Nespresso Vertuo Plus is one of two new-style machines to join the Nespresso range in 2017. It's smaller than the other models, which allows it to fit into more space. It comes in more colours.

The machine uses the latest incarnation of Nespresso's pod-based coffee system. Instead of piercing the capsule to pump hot water through it the Vertuo Plus uses Centrifusion to spin the capsule around at speeds of up to 7000rpm. The brew is made by mixing ground coffee with water. The capsule coffee makers dribbles out of the 18 smaller holes and through the central hole and gives your drink a richer crema. The machine can make espresso-style and lungo-style drinks.

It reads the barcode located at the bottom of each capsule to customize its blending method for each. This is the reason you can't use capsules from other brands using the Vertuo Plus Nespresso's capsules - only Nespresso's own come with the barcode.

It's easy to use, by pressing a single button across the top. Just click the silver lever in the front and it'll raise to reveal a place for your chosen pod. Place the pod coffee machines in place, then press the single button to start the brewing.

The machine comes with a 40-ounce reservoir of water and it automatically releases capsules used up internally. It has a heating period of about 15 seconds and a shut-off feature that automatically shuts off after nine minutes. It's a stylish and reliable machine with minimal maintenance. 3. Tassimo My Way

Fully automated machine with an extremely simple operation. It features a wide cup platform that can be set at different heights, to fit tall glasses as well as small espresso cups, and it's easy to pick the settings you prefer using the numbered buttons. The machine can store four different variations. It's an excellent choice for couples or families with different preferences. The machine is energy efficient and features an easy-to-read indicator that tells you when it's time to descaling (which requires an instruction disc to be tucked in a slot).

It's designed to work like other Tassimo systems with the company's branded barcoded T Discs which include everything from cold drinks, coffee, tea, hot chocolate, and cold drinks, to chilled, frothy milk. It comes with Intellibrew technology, which automatically recognises the kind of drink and adjusts the the brewing time, temperature, and strength in accordance with the drink. This prevents you from accidentally changing settings that aren't logical, such as the strength of coffee brewed with milk. It also ensures that your beverage tastes consistently good.

The My Way 2 has an extensive selection of flavors to choose from, featuring more than 50 well-known brands including Costa favourites, Kenco, L'OR and Cadbury's. You can even make lattes and cappuccinos that are frothy, as well as uplifting Americanos and delicious flat whites.

It is easy to clean and has an automatic standby mode that conserves energy. The water tank can be easy to remove and is filled with fresh tap water. Unlike some pod machines, it does not have a built-in mechanism to dispose of used T Discs, but it has formed a partnership with Podback to enable you to recycle them using a local scheme.
